Key facts from Nolen Farm's documents
- Community type
- HOA (Homeowners Association, Inc.) (Article I, Section 4)
- Legal name
- Nolen Farm Homeowners Association, Inc. (PREAMBLE (inferred from 'Nolen Farm Home)
- Units / lots
- Not explicitly stated, but multiple Lots referenced (General)
- Developer / declarant
- Presley Development LLC (PREAMBLE and Article I, Section 12)
- Governing law
- North Carolina Planned Community Act, Chapter 47F of the North Carolina General Statutes (Article I, Section 1)
- Assessments & dues
- Initial annual assessment for Class A Lot: $840.00 until December 31, 2020. For Class C Lots: 40% of Class A. For Development Parcel not owned by Declarant: $100.00 per acre. For Class B Lots and Development Parcels owned by Class B Member: (Article V, Section 3)
- Special assessments
- May be levied for capital improvements, etc.; requires approval of Declarant and majority of votes of non-Declarant members. Special assessments for Class C and Class B are zero. (Article V, Section 6)
- Collections & liens
- Unpaid assessments after 30 days become a lien on the Lot; Association may file claim of lien and foreclose; personal obligation of owner at time assessment fell due. (Article V, Sections 1 and 9)
- Reserves & fees
- Association shall establish separate reserve account for repairs and replacements of Common Area. (Article V, Section 14)

- Voting & meetings
- Three classes: Class A (non-Declarant, non-Builder owners) 1 vote per Lot; Class B (Declarant) 99 votes per Lot and 99 votes per acre of Development Parcel; Class C (Builders) 1 vote per Lot (Article III, Section 2)
